Sala Udin

Sala Udin, whose legal name is Samuel Wesley Howze, is a former Pittsburgh City Councilman where he represented the 6th district. Udin has been known for the voice that he gave to the primarily poor and oppressed people that he represented. Udin was succeeded by Tonya Payne in a primary election in 2005. Udin has been associated with the work he did during the Civil Rights Movement in the South. Udin is also known for his acting in the play Jitney and the friendship he had with the author of the play August Wilson.
